Temperature
The temperature in Moorooduc varies significantly throughout the year, with warm summers and cool winters. The average maximum temperature ranges from 16°C (61°F) in winter to 27°C (80°F) in summer. January is typically the warmest month, while July is the coldest. It is essential to pack accordingly, with lighter clothing during summer and warmer layers for the winter months.
Here is a table displaying the average monthly maximum and minimum temperatures in Moorooduc:
Month | Average Maximum Temperature (°C) | Average Minimum Temperature (°C) |
---|---|---|
January | 27 | 14 |
February | 26 | 14 |
March | 24 | 12 |
April | 21 | 10 |
May | 18 | 8 |
June | 15 | 6 |
July | 15 | 6 |
August | 16 | 6 |
September | 18 | 7 |
October | 20 | 9 |
November | 23 | 11 |
December | 25 | 13 |
Precipitation
Moorooduc receives a moderate amount of rainfall throughout the year, with the wettest months typically occurring between May and October. The average annual precipitation in Moorooduc is around 700 millimeters (27.6 inches). It is advisable to carry an umbrella or raincoat during these months to stay dry.

Sunshine Hours
Moorooduc enjoys a significant number of sunshine hours throughout the year, making it a pleasant destination for outdoor activities and vineyard tours. On average, Moorooduc experiences around 2,200 hours of sunshine annually. The summer months, especially January and February, have the highest number of sunshine hours, while the winter months have relatively fewer hours of sunlight.
Here is a table displaying the average monthly sunshine hours in Moorooduc:
Month | Sunshine Hours |
---|---|
January | 250 |
February | 230 |
March | 200 |
April | 150 |
May | 140 |
June | 140 |
July | 150 |
August | 160 |
September | 180 |
October | 200 |
November | 220 |
December | 240 |
Wind
Moorooduc experiences prevailing winds that come from the west and southwest directions. These winds are influenced by the surrounding topography and the coastal location of the Mornington Peninsula. The wind speed in Moorooduc ranges from gentle breezes to moderate gusts, with average speeds ranging from 10 to 25 kilometers per hour (6 to 16 miles per hour).
Frost
Frost can occur in Moorooduc during the winter months, especially in low-lying areas and open spaces. The risk of frost is higher in the early morning hours when temperatures are at their lowest. It is advisable to take precautionary measures to protect sensitive plants and crops from frost damage during this time.
